How they compare
Costa Rica currently reports 781.24 current US$ against 702.53 current US$ in Saint Kitts and Nevis, a difference of 78.71 current US$.
That makes Costa Rica's figure about 1.1 times Saint Kitts and Nevis's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Saint Kitts and Nevis ahead.
Costa Rica ranks 59th and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 61st of 193 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Costa Rica averaged higher in 2 and Saint Kitts and Nevis in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Costa Rica | Saint Kitts and Nevis |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 236.36 current US$ | 253.27 current US$ | 16.91 current US$ | Saint Kitts and Nevis |
| 2010s | 602.15 current US$ | 423.88 current US$ | 178.28 current US$ | Costa Rica |
| 2020s | 710 current US$ | 634.88 current US$ | 75.11 current US$ | Costa Rica |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
